If i put extension tracks in my hair, and i got to a salon, can a stylist style it for me?

They can't really charge more because it's just like styling real hair. They, however, may not want to do it because they don't know how. My advice? Go to an african american based salon and they will be more than happy to style it for you and often at a fraction of the cost. Just be carefu when you want them out, make sure you use an oil based lubricant to slide the tracks out rather than ripping them off your head (it hurts!) Good luck!

If i put extension tracks in my hair, and i got to a salon, can a stylist style it for me?

Usually when the extensions are put in the extensions are cut and styled at the end of the service and should be included. But make sure you ask if you have not been to this tech before. After that, you will be charged for styling if you come in for regular blow outs. Best of luck.
